A stone of mass 1.4 kg raises the level of water from 200 ml to 900 ml. Find its density in SI unit​

Answer: 2kg/l or 2000kg/m^{3}

Explanation:

density = mass/volume

mass= 1.4kg

volume = 900ml-200ml=700ml

covert ml to l, 700ml = 700 x 10^{-3} = 0.7l

but 1m^{3} = 1000l

x= \frac{0.7 x 1}{1000} = 7x10^{-4}m^{3}

density = 1.4kg/7x10^{-4}

            =2000kg/m^{3}
